Output c3cdebef6bb2c7096fe59c2decc7a6aa0bf1d73ab4f88c341ea84dfed5e36836:2

value
1680994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 541ab9d5ec80d850715555c1542eebadbd5a943d OP_EQUAL
address
39MihcAG6vZ3Xp4JZnaDHLPpq941LPvadv
transaction
c3cdebef6bb2c7096fe59c2decc7a6aa0bf1d73ab4f88c341ea84dfed5e36836
confirmations
300259
spent
true